Context and Background
Leylah Fernandez’s ascent to financial prominence began with her meteoric breakthrough at the 2021 US Open, where she reached the final as an unseeded teenager. That single event transformed her from a promising prospect into a global marketing asset. Since 2021, her financial profile has evolved from reliance on prize money to a sophisticated mix of long-term partnership agreements.
The 2026 season has seen Fernandez maintain a consistent presence in the WTA top tier. Her financial growth is heavily bolstered by her status as a "first-choice" athlete for premium brands. In 2024 and 2025, she solidified her brand identity by securing multi-year deals that emphasize her role as a youth icon and a cross-cultural influencer. Unlike many players who rely solely on tournament prize pots, Fernandez’s earnings are heavily insulated by her off-court commercial activity, which accounts for an estimated 60-70% of her annual gross income.
